Players To Watch:

Edmonton Oilers

Ryan Nugent-Hopkins has faced the Stars 36 times in his career, recording 21 points on six goals and 15 assists; in three meetings last season, he had two assists.

Dallas Stars

Jason Robertson has faced the Oilers 12 times in his career, recording 17 points on eight goals and nine assists; he scored four goals and added two assists in three games against Edmonton last season.
